E!: Now that your kids are getting a little older, is it easier to shop for them now that they have more opinions? Or are they very particular about what they love for the holidays?
LC: It's both. It's helpful because they can tell you what they want, right? However, sometimes the things they want are not ideal. It can be great though. I had my older son write a letter to Santa, which became my shopping list. That couldn't be any easier, but he included a pet fish, which means I have to get him a pet fish that I will have to take care of.

E!: There are so many different ways to approach shopping for kids gifts, from something educational, to fun toys, to clothes. What route is your go-to?
LC: I usually don't buy my kids clothes just because I buy them clothes throughout the year, but I do tend to get clothes for other people's kids.

For toys, I try to be thoughtful, from a couple different perspectives. If it's someone I'm close with and I'm familiar with their home, I will think about it aesthetically and get toys and stuffed animals that look nice in their home with their decor. I try not to buy battery-powered, loud gifts for my friend's kids. I consider it to be "do unto others as you would have them do unto you."

Whether it's an add-on or a main gift, I usually give our knit little characters from Little Market. My favorite one is the little polar bear, but we have tons of different options that appeal to different tastes and interests, which are all cute. They're kind of smaller and handmade. It's a nice gift for a little person. It's funny because the amount of stuffed animals you accumulate really do add up. I have some really beautiful ones that my kids have been gifted over the years. I always try to keep those ones out and the other ones get tossed into the closet. I try to pick the cuter ones that you don't mind sitting around the house.
